Dr. Abdulhamid M. Mousa is a pioneering researcher in the field of medical robotics and minimally invasive surgical devices, with a particular focus on capsule-type mechanisms for soft tissue intervention. His most notable contribution is the design and development of a novel capsule-type device for soft tissue cutting, which employs a threadless ballscrew actuator—a breakthrough that eliminates the need for traditional threaded components, reducing mechanical complexity and improving reliability in confined spaces. This work, published in 2019, introduces a small-scale gripper mechanism composed of three cone-shaped structures that precisely hold and cut tissue samples, enabling safer and more efficient biopsy procedures.
